Episode synopsis

This episode of animal photographer Iwago Mitsuaki's popular series takes him to Cambodia in Southeast Asia. The shoot took place during the dry season, where stilt houses on the shores of a lake are 6m above ground level. At this time of year, shops are set up in the open air, and cats roam among them. Iwago aimed to capture the movements of these cats. In the humid and muggy climate of Cambodia, hammocks are perfect for taking afternoon naps, and a kitty is napping underneath it, when something happens. A cat is also spotted strolling among the ruins of Angkor Wat, and its beautiful silhouette against the setting sun is also a highlight

About Mitsuaki Iwago's World “Cats” Travelogue

Prominent Japanese wildlife photographer and filmmaker Mitsuaki Iwago loves cats of all shapes and sizes. So he's set out on a journey to film cats all over the world as they live their lives.
